A modular aluminum ramp is a cost-effective and durable solution for your mobility needs. It is usually made up of sections that are constructed off-site, then delivered to the location for rapid assembly. The PATHWAY 3G Modular Access System from EZ-ACCESS is a great illustration of this type of ramp. It offers many advantages over wooden ramps.

As opposed to wood, aluminium isn't prone to discoloration or deterioration from the elements. It is also rust-resistant and easy to maintain, making it an ideal material for ramps for wheelchairs. It is also light and durable. Its strength and light weight make it a popular option for outdoor or indoor ramps.

Steel is a more durable option than aluminium, but it is susceptible to corrosion over time. To prevent rusting and keep the ramp safe, it is important to paint or coat the ramp with a coating regularly. It could also be very heavy and requires an extra strong support system.

Wood ramps are a great choice for many because they have a natural look and blend into any interior. They can be constructed by anyone with a basic understanding of construction or with the help of an expert. It is important that the ramp adheres to ADA guidelines. The ramp should have a minimum of 36 inches clearance from side to side, and it should have an even landing at the top and bottom. The ramp should also be able to support the weight of the rubber wheelchair ramps for home.

If you're planning to construct a wooden wheelchair ramp you must consider the entry point to your home as well as the space available to create the ramp. Using the right material is also essential. Choose a material that is durable and can endure the elements. It is also important to ensure that the wood you choose is treated to prevent rotting. If you don't use a quality wood, the ramp will deteriorate quickly and require more maintenance to ensure it is safe for use.

Another option is an aluminum ramp, which is light and easy to install. These ramps are typically sold in modular sections, and are able to be disassembled and then reinstalled. They are also less expensive than wooden ramps and require less maintenance. Aluminium ramps are a good choice for outdoor use since they are weatherproof and can withstand harsh conditions. They can withstand rain, snow and ice.

When selecting the material for your ramp, take into consideration the type of assistive device you want to use. You must ensure that the ramp is capable of accommodating your preferred device such as an walker or cane or an electric or manual wheelchair. If you own a motorized wheelchair you must ensure that the ramp has enough slope to allow for an easy and comfortable ride.

When building a ramp, make sure to follow local codes. Check with your homeowner's association or city hall to find out if any permits are required. You should also be aware of ADA requirements, like the minimum width inside between handrails and the handrails.

Another aspect to consider when selecting the right ramp is the slope of the slope. A standard ramp should have an 1 in 12 slope, which means that for every inch of height difference the ramp should be 12 inches in length. This is the most comfortable and safest slope for wheelchairs, however you should check the local codes first to confirm that it is required.

A properly designed ramp should have rails to stop people from falling off the edge. Even the most careful user may slip or fall off the edge of a ramp. If a person who has a disability falls off the edge of the ramp, they can become trapped and require emergency rescue. A good ramp design should include guardrails to protect those from injury or death.

While steel ramps are most sought-after, aluminum ramps offer many advantages over steel. Aluminum ramps are lighter, rust-resistant, and less expensive than steel ones. Steel ramps, on the other hand, are better suited to high-traffic areas and heavy loads, since they are more robust.

Wooden ramps are typically constructed from a form of wood, which makes them susceptible to rot and general degradation over time. They require regular maintenance to avoid splintering and decay. They are not suited to wet climates, and wheelchairs could find them slippery.

Concrete ramps are expensive to build and require a permit. They can be constructed to a custom height however, they are not typically suitable for steep slopes. They aren't movable which makes them a poor option for people who may need to relocate in the near future.
